#7c43f9 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7c43f9 is composed of 48.6% red, 26.3% green and 97.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50.2% cyan, 73.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 258.8 degrees, a saturation of 93.8% and a lightness of 62%. #7c43f9 color hex could be obtained by blending #f886ff with #0000f3. Closest websafe color is: #6633ff.

#7c43f9 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7c43f9 has RGB values of R:124, G:67, B:249 and CMYK values of C:0.5, M:0.73, Y:0,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 8143865.
